User security is always Cobo's central priority, and for that reason, we do not plan to release a desktop version. Desktop wallets are as a whole more vulnerable than mobile wallets (due to the increased threat of keyloggers, trojans, and other malware). Mobile apps are less risky because they generally are required to have certifications and, on systems that haven't been jailbroken/rooted, apps within your wallets are separated in terms of security. Mobile phones also have an encrypted space to store sensitive information too.

For Cobo Wallet, we generate steady revenue through our innovative staking pools. We're actually one of the biggest PoS pools in the world. Users that hold their crypto with us can join our staking pools and earn rewards for helping us validate transactions on the blockchain. Users get a safe place to hold their crypto and we do POS mining and give rewards to users. It's a win-win situation.

We get asked this a lot, and we see that there are three main advantages:
1. The Ledger can only store around 10 coins simutaneously, we have a 256K flash memory on encryption chip and 8G memory on the OS, we can store an almost ulimited amount of different coins.

  1. We meet the US military durability standard, MIL-STD-810G. Which can protect your hardware wallet from water, high & low temparature, being dropped and temparature shock, plus more.

  2. We have a series of security mechanisms, including self-destruct mechanisms and multi-siganature.

Good question - We usually stop mining once the cost of electricity exceeds the value of the crypto we're mining.

Those are Avalon 741s. not S7s. We turned off the S7s a long time ago. We're using S9s these days. Their BTC production exceeds their electricity cost by about 20%.
